Re: [PATCH v4 7/9] NFSD: Prevent client use-after-free during blocked-lock reaping

On Thu, 2026-07-09 at 13:40 -0400, Chuck Lever wrote:
> A bare lock owner -- its only remaining reference a blocked lock on
> nn->blocked_locks_lru -- holds a raw pointer to its nfs4_client but
> no reference keeping the client alive. When the per-net laundromat
> reaps such a lock, freeing the nbl drops the owner reference
> held through flc_owner, and the final nfs4_put_stateowner()
> takes the client's cl_lock. Because the laundromat detaches the
> nbl first, __destroy_client() no longer finds it, so a concurrent
> force_expire_client() can free the client before nfs4_put_stateowner()
> runs, dereferencing cl_lock in freed memory.
>
> Pin the client with cl_rpc_users before dropping
> nn->blocked_locks_lock, and skip clients already expiring, whose
> blocked locks __destroy_client() frees while holding an owner
> reference. Take nn->client_lock outside nn->blocked_locks_lock.
> Every other site holds nn->blocked_locks_lock as a leaf, acquiring
> no further lock, so placing nn->client_lock outside it cannot form
> a lock-order cycle.
